2.读取csv文件代码如下:
时间: 2023-10-06 17:04:30 浏览: 62
好的,以下是读取CSV文件的代码示例:
```python
import pandas as pd
# 读取CSV文件
df = pd.read_csv('file.csv')
# 显示前5行
print(df.head())
```
在上面的示例中,我们使用pandas库的read_csv函数读取CSV文件,并将其保存为DataFrame对象。然后使用DataFrame对象的head函数显示前5行数据。
如果CSV文件中包含列名,则可以使用header参数指定标题所在的行数。例如,如果标题位于第一行,则可以使用以下代码:
```python
df = pd.read_csv('file.csv', header=0)
```
如果CSV文件中包含日期或时间戳数据,则可以使用parse_dates参数将其解析为datetime对象。例如,如果日期列名为'date',则可以使用以下代码:
```python
df = pd.read_csv('file.csv', parse_dates=['date'])
```
这样可以方便地进行时间序列分析。
相关问题
vue通过d3.csv读取csv文件
在Vue中通过d3.csv读取csv文件可以按照以下步骤来实现:
1. 安装d3.js
首先需要在项目中安装d3.js,可以使用npm命令进行安装:
```
npm install d3
```
2. 引入d3.js
在需要使用的组件中引入d3.js:
```javascript
import * as d3 from 'd3'
```
3. 读取csv文件
在组件中使用d3.csv方法读取csv文件,该方法返回一个Promise对象,可以使用then方法获取读取到的数据:
```javascript
d3.csv('data.csv').then(data => {
console.log(data)
})
```
完整的代码如下:
```javascript
<template>
<div>
<h1>读取csv文件</h1>
</div>
</template>
<script>
import * as d3 from 'd3'
export default {
mounted() {
d3.csv('data.csv').then(data => {
console.log(data)
})
}
}
</script>
```
需要注意的是,需要将csv文件放置在项目的public文件夹中,否则d3无法读取到该文件。
ifstream inFile("..\\..\\9101exe\\setup.csv", ios::in);这段代码什么意思
这段代码是用来创建一个输入文件流对象,并打开名为"setup.csv"的文件。具体解释如下:
- `ifstream` 是C++标准库中的一个输入文件流类,用于从文件中读取数据。
- `inFile` 是我们创建的输入文件流对象的名称,你可以根据需要自定义。
- `"..\\..\\9101exe\\setup.csv"` 是文件的路径和名称。在这个例子中,文件位于当前目录的上两级目录下的"9101exe"文件夹中,并且文件名为"setup.csv"。
- `ios::in` 是打开文件的模式,表示以输入方式打开文件。
总结起来,这段代码的作用是创建一个输入文件流对象,并打开名为"setup.csv"的文件,以便后续可以从该文件中读取数据。